What makes these so excellent is that they're CARDBOARD, you can paint 'em, cut 'em, tear 'em, stamp on 'em, whatever you want, PERFECT for collage! The cardboard is as you see in the scan up top, but it can be painted or dyed any color or colors you like, stamped, whatever!! The possibilities are endless, I'm so excited to have found them! I'd love to see them used as doll bodies, ornaments, in shrines! (OH! And don't forget you can use the little letter parts you punch out of the stencils, too!) The bigger ones would make excellent book pages! They come packaged as complete alphabet (upper case only) with numbers and some punctuation, with an extra A, E, O, R and S in each package (except for the 1/2" size, which for some reason doesn't include those extra letters).
